We are looking for an experienced all round mobile plant operator to join the team in site services (NOT PRODUCTION or CONSTRUCTION.)
This is a critical operational role focusing on daily maintenance of access roads, laydown areas and carparks. Managing the rubbish tip - push up waste, cover and compact, maintaining containment structures. Support maintenance teams with access preparation (clearing, leveling, trenching), maintain hardstand areas, storage yards, and fuel areas and various other ad hoc tasks that ensure the site and village infrastructure remain safe, functionable and compliant.

Established in 2018, The Aurenne Group is a privately owned gold exploration & mining company whose focus is on select gold projects determined to be worthy of Aurenne's time and capital.
Being a relatively new entrant into the Gold Mining Industry, Aurenne is consistently & carefully building both its human and physical resources.
Aurenne has a highly stable financial structure to drive its expansion & endeavours at all times to conduct itself with the highest level of innovation & integrity. The project has entered the construction phase to establish a 1.2 mtpa CIL gold plant by April next year. Mining operations will commence in October this year.
